How Thermal Imaging Leak Detection Works
We take a methodical approach to thermal imaging leak detection, using specialized equipment to scan your property and identify hidden leaks. Our process typically begins with a thorough inspection of your home or business, where we’ll look for signs of water damage such as warping or discoloration.
Step 1: Inspection and Preparation
Our technicians will carefully inspect your property looking for areas where water may be entering or accumulating. We’ll also clear the area to ensure a clear path for our equipment.
Step 2: Thermal Imaging Scan
We’ll use specialized thermal imaging cameras to scan your property detecting even the smallest leaks. This non-invasive process is quick and painless and won’t damage your walls or floors.
Step 3: Leak Detection and Repair
Once we’ve identified the source of the leak, our team will repair the damage and ensure your property is water-tight. We’ll also provide recommendations for preventing future leaks.

Thermal Imaging Leak Detection Cost in Brockton, MA
The cost of thermal imaging leak detection in Brockton, MA, can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area. Here are some estimated price ranges for our services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Thermal imaging scan | $200 – $1,000 | The size of the area to be scanned and the severity of the leak. |
| Leak detection and repair | $500 – $2,500 | The size and complexity of the leak, as well as the materials needed for repair. |
| Water damage restoration | $1,000 – $5,000 | The extent of the water damage and the materials needed for restoration. |
| Preventative maintenance | $100 – $500 | The frequency and scope of the maintenance service. |
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and a free estimate is available upon request.
